I suggested this to STRAVA but got nothing. I would like to see the coordinates of the crosshair cursor over each STRAVA Analysis graph. As it is, I can try to read the horizontal coordinate on the time or distance scale, but that's very coarse. The vertical coord on the right side of the graph shows the value of the trace, not not the crosshairs. I can use the crosshairs coordinates to measure intervals and estimate power/hr/cadence over an interval etc...

Hi @git-dyup I don't want to get your hopes up. The code Strava uses for that graph is pretty gnarly D3 code and Sauce only sees the final minified version of it. So making modifications to it is exhausting and error prone.
Hey. Thanks for the response. I think it's something that could be quite useful. As it is, I can zoom in on the horizontal scale and use averaging to get at what I want, but that's def more involved than simply moving to the corsshairs and reading off its coords. No worries.
